How do stakeholders map ecological connectivity? Discourse analysis of French planning instruments dedicated to
Anissa Bellil1, Emeline Comby2, Jean-Christophe Foltête3
1Marie and Louis Pasteur University, CNRS, ThéMA, 32 rue Mégevand, 25000, Besançon Cedex, France. anissa.bellil@umlp.fr.
Habitat networks in French territorial planning instruments are mapped differently due to stakeholder interpretations. This study reveals four discourse categories influencing these spatial representations and planning practices.

Background:
- Habitat networks are crucial for biodiversity and ecological connectivity in land-use planning.
- Stakeholder interpretations lead to varied approaches in mapping these networks within planning instruments.
- Understanding these variations is key to effective conservation strategies.
Purpose of the Study:
- To analyze how habitat networks are spatially represented in French territorial planning instruments.
- To investigate the influence of stakeholder discourse on mapping practices.
- To identify challenges in integrating ecological connectivity into planning.
Main Methods:
- Mixed-methods approach combining textometry and qualitative analysis.
- Analysis of 21 "Schémas de Cohérence Territoriale" (SCoTs) in Bourgogne Franche-Comté.
- Examination of semi-structured interviews and spatial mappings of habitat networks.
Main Results:
- Significant variation in habitat network representations across SCoTs.
- Identification of four distinct discourse categories influencing mapping approaches (scientific to political).
- Methodological constraints contribute to the diversity of spatial transposition.
Conclusions:
- The link between discourse and mapping practice is evident in territorial planning.
- Divergent interpretations and methodological issues pose challenges for ecological connectivity integration.
- Insights gained can improve the implementation of habitat networks in planning.
